Descriptive sheet SENSINITRYL PRO
Description
Disposable non-sterile, powder-free nitrile gloves.
Latex- and phthalate-free, protects against possible allergic reactions related to natural rubber latex proteins. Blue in color, ambidextrous with tear-resistant cuff. Micro-roughened surface ensures maximum sensitivity and a better grip. Excellent chemical resistance to disinfectants and the main substances used in the chemical/pharmaceutical field.
The glove must be put on before starting work. The choice of glove should be based on the operator's knowledge of the work activity and the work process, taking into account the working conditions and associated risks.
Keep the packaging for further information and to ensure traceability. This product does not require a safety data sheet.
Indicated to protect the user and patient from biological risks deriving from microbial contamination and contamination by chemical agents in clinical settings (examination, exploration, therapy, diagnostics), dental, pharmaceutical, and chemical industries. Suitable for use by any patient with latex allergies. Not suitable for users/patients with nitrile allergies.
How to use
Disposable gloves for use in chemically and mechanically non-aggressive activities. Keep the packaging for further information and to ensure traceability. Avoid direct exposure to sunlight, ozone, and heat sources. Always perform a preliminary test under actual conditions of use. Do not use the gloves in contact with the tested chemical for periods exceeding the performance level (0<10 min; 1>10 min; 2>30 min; 3>60 min; 4>120 min; 5>240 min; 6>480 min). Wear the gloves with dry, clean hands. This product does not require a safety data sheet.
Warnings
Avoid direct exposure to sunlight, ozone, and heat sources. Disposable only; the device is not reusable to prevent cross-contamination. Avoid using gloves in situations where there is a risk of entanglement in moving machine parts. The material may contain traces of chemical residues from processing which, while not detectable in laboratory tests, could be potentially dangerous for hypersensitive individuals (potential type IV chemical allergens). In case of confirmed hypersensitivity, request the Technical Data Sheet from the manufacturer. Contraindicated for patients and users sensitive or allergic to nitrile. Use on hands with long or unkempt nails or rings could cause the device to tear. This information does not reflect the actual duration of protection in the workplace or the distinction between mixtures and pure chemical products. Chemical resistance was evaluated under laboratory conditions using samples taken from the palm only (except when the glove is 400 mm or longer, in which case the cuff is also tested) and is related only to the chemical being tested. Resistance may differ if the chemical is used in a mixture. It is recommended that gloves be tested for their intended use, as workplace conditions may differ from the type test, depending on temperature, abrasion, and degradation. During use, protective gloves may provide reduced resistance to hazardous chemicals due to changes in physical properties. Movement, rubbing, and deterioration caused by chemical contact, etc., can significantly reduce effective wear time. For corrosive chemicals, degradation may be the most important factor to consider when selecting chemical-resistant gloves. In the event of serious accidents occurring while using the device, the user must promptly report them to the manufacturer and the competent authorities.
Conservation
Store gloves in their original packaging in a dry, clean place, avoiding direct exposure to sunlight, heat sources, and humidity.
Shelf life when packaged intact: 60 months.
